The Pathless wraps you with its agile mechanics and a sense of freedom. It is ecstatic to explore the world as the Huntress, who jumps and runs with speed and style while shooting arrows at targets. Progression is free and the vast settings have a lot of puzzles and story context, but the limited variety gets tiring after a while. The visuals, the music and the ambiance create an adventure with a contemplative feel, however the simplicity of many aspects is uncomfortable. In the end, The Pathless offers a unique, if not very memorable, journey.

The Pathless is a gorgeous adventure with an entertaining traversal mechanic and a subtle but effective narrative. Running, jumping, and gliding around with your eagle friend while solving enigmatic puzzles is a real joy. While some lackluster stealth sections and difficulty maneuvering during some boss sections are present, it doesn’t take away from the overall experience. Whatever direction you decide to travel, The Pathless leads you to some special gaming moments.
